@Generated(value="org.openapitools.codegen.languages.JavaSmartxClientCodegen") public class CloudInitNetWork extends Object
| 限定符和类型 | 字段和说明 |
|---|---|
static String |
SERIALIZED_NAME_IP_ADDRESS |
static String |
SERIALIZED_NAME_NETMASK |
static String |
SERIALIZED_NAME_NIC_INDEX |
static String |
SERIALIZED_NAME_ROUTES |
static String |
SERIALIZED_NAME_TYPE |
| 构造器和说明 |
|---|
CloudInitNetWork() |
| 限定符和类型 | 方法和说明 |
|---|---|
CloudInitNetWork |
addRoutesItem(CloudInitNetWorkRoute routesItem) |
boolean |
equals(Object o) |
String |
getIpAddress()
Get ipAddress
|
String |
getNetmask()
Get netmask
|
Integer |
getNicIndex()
Get nicIndex
|
List<CloudInitNetWorkRoute> |
getRoutes()
Get routes
|
CloudInitNetworkTypeEnum |
getType()
Get type
|
int |
hashCode() |
CloudInitNetWork |
ipAddress(String ipAddress) |
CloudInitNetWork |
netmask(String netmask) |
CloudInitNetWork |
nicIndex(Integer nicIndex) |
CloudInitNetWork |
routes(List<CloudInitNetWorkRoute> routes) |
void |
setIpAddress(String ipAddress) |
void |
setNetmask(String netmask) |
void |
setNicIndex(Integer nicIndex) |
void |
setRoutes(List<CloudInitNetWorkRoute> routes) |
void |
setType(CloudInitNetworkTypeEnum type) |
String |
toString() |
CloudInitNetWork |
type(CloudInitNetworkTypeEnum type) |
public CloudInitNetWork routes(List<CloudInitNetWorkRoute> routes)
public CloudInitNetWork addRoutesItem(CloudInitNetWorkRoute routesItem)
@Nullable public List<CloudInitNetWorkRoute> getRoutes()
public void setRoutes(List<CloudInitNetWorkRoute> routes)
public CloudInitNetWork type(CloudInitNetworkTypeEnum type)
@Nonnull public CloudInitNetworkTypeEnum getType()
public void setType(CloudInitNetworkTypeEnum type)
public CloudInitNetWork nicIndex(Integer nicIndex)
public void setNicIndex(Integer nicIndex)
public CloudInitNetWork netmask(String netmask)
public void setNetmask(String netmask)
public CloudInitNetWork ipAddress(String ipAddress)
public void setIpAddress(String ipAddress)
Copyright © 2025. All rights reserved.